The visa candidate need to be lawfully acceptable to the United States, go to the very least 18 years old, intend to occupy legal irreversible home in the US, and meet the lawful meaning of a certified financier. Targeted employment locations are geographical areas with an unemployment price of at the very least 150% of the nationwide average at the time of the application and financial investment.
When the capitalist shows the high joblessness requirement, they might qualify for a smaller sized financial investment, according to migration law. High joblessness rates can be collected either with public documents or by getting a letter from a competent state government firm. One more way to classify a TEA is if it is considered a country area.

If you fulfill all of the demands for the EB-5 investor program, you may be qualified to get a permit (legal copyright card). You will get a conditional house eco-friendly card initially, and after that you will certainly need to prove to the federal government that you have actually promoted your end of the deal with your financial investment and petition for the government to eliminate conditions to ensure that you can obtain a permanent environment-friendly card.

In the world of EB-5 financial investments, most of financial investments are structured to fulfill the requirements of a Targeted Employment Area (TEA). By locating the investment in a TEA, investors come to be qualified for the reduced investment threshold, which currently stands at $800,000. Buying a TEA not just enables investors to make a lower capital financial investment but additionally supplies a brand-new course of visas that have no waiting line, and investments into a rural location get approved for top priority processing.
